Ah, Pinkie Pie. An innocent mare with her equally innocent family. he pink pony always found amusement in baking, parties, and pulling off harmless pranks, then came the black miasma. Sickening, gooey thing it was, washing over the lands like a wave of death and disease. Pinkie had visited her family's rock farm for the week and was helping her sisters out while the parents were out, purchasing supplies. Inkie, a wee gray pony, stopped tending to the stones and looked up towards the sky, curious.

"Hey, what's that coming towards us?" she asked.

Pinkie and Blinkie both stopped tending to their stones and looked upwards to see a veil of black mist rushing towards them.

"Looks like clouds," Pinkie squinted from atop Blinkie's shoulders.

"Hmmmm," Blinkie hummed. "First, get off my shoulders. Second, Maybe it's a sign of rain? I've never seen a phenomenon like that before."

"Maybe we should get inside before--"

Inkie was cut short by the miasma engulfing the farm and blasting the ponies across its lands like they were hit by a massively powerful hurricane. The three ponies took some time to recover from the blast and checked the farm and its lands for any damages. Pinkie wiped her forehead in relief and slumped against a rock.

"I don't know what that was, but it surr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rre was fun," she said.

Inkie looked back at where she first viewed the miasma and frowned. "I still think it's weird that it only blew us away."

"I guess you could say that it...blows," Pinkie snickered.

Blinkie resisted the urge to strangle her sister.

"Well, if that's all there is," Inkie started. "then we should get back to work."

"Can't we have a wind party, just because we weren't blown away?" Pinkie hopped in place. "I've never done a wind party. I just want to do one here!"

The other two ponies looked at each other bemusingly and rolled their eyes in unison. "Yes. Fine. Okay," they both said.

"Yay!"

Not all ponies are immediately affected by the miasma, and some aren't affected at all, but in the case of the former, the afflicted ponies never pay attention and start viewing 'normal' ponies as disgusting monsters. Pinkie's pranks to the ponies in the towns around her home farm became more and more extreme in execution, with some being absolutely terrified and some outright hurting a pony, but not killing them of course. She wouldn't think of doing that...at least, not to 'fellow' ponies. Just as the three sisters' continued their daily lives through the week and the absence of their parents became a distant memory until they were the only ones remaining, so too die the changes to their forms and names continue. Pinkie's coat went from hot pink, to pale red, and then a dark red. Her mouth lost consistency and became a morphing addle of black holes while her eyes turned into ever-leaking orbs of a black substance and her pupils became little gleams of red lights. Her name was now 'Zalgy Pie', and she had a passion for extreme parties.

Inkie's body became a sheen of gray while her hair puffed up like her energetic sister's, and changed to a glowing white. Her teeth broken and reshaped themselves into a solid row of sharp clamps that glowed in the dark, much like her mane and pupils, pupils which had adopted the form of an angular spiral in seas of dark. Her body now secreted oils whose properties she could manipulate at will. Now long was Inkie Pie so adamant about helping at the farm and growing the best rocks. Oily Pie was more concerned with creating the best rocks from any source of minerals.

Blinkie's entire body warped into the same shade of deep cerulean blue while her eyes, still black like her sisters, had their pupils turn into four-point stars of a bright cerulean, staring at you from across the cosmos. Her teeth receded and her lips morphed into jagged edges more than capable of serving their purposes, and the ends of her mouth were twirled, making her smile for all eternity. Now called Dready Cake, she was the calmest of the three and always had a smile on her face no matter what task she performed. How exhilarating.

"Hey, let's take a picture together," Zalgy suggested. "It's been a while since we did one."

Oily patted her face, making oil splatter everywhere including Dready's smiling face. "Sure. What do you think, Dread?"

The blue pony lifted her forehooves up in semblance of giving a thumbs up. "I'm all for it."

"Then get ready for the picture!" Zalgy cheered.

She gathered with her sisters and smiled. The camera went off, but Zalgy wasn't happy with it when she picked it up from the floor.

"Ah, some jam fell onto it. Let me fix the hold for the camera."

A muffled scream was left ignored by the two waiting ponies while Zalgy adjusted the camera.

"Pranking sure does have its advantages," Zalgy commented. "Alrighty then. It's fully functional now, hopefully. I don't like readjusting the camera holder." She wrapped her forelegs around her sisters and smiled. "Say 'party'!"
